Kelly grew up in this 6-bedroom, 4-bath home that was built by her father in the 1920s. Besides the fact that it was the childhood home of a future princess, it’s also where the Prince of Monaco proposed to the Oscar award-winning actress.

The childhood home of Princess Grace Kelly in East Falls has hit the market for a solid $1 million, a couple of years after the home's interiors were discovered in an unfortunate state.
